Breathing Thin – How Less Becomes More

Life at high altitudes brings with it a breath of challenges, notably thinner air and decreased oxygen availability. Our bodies adapt to these conditions through hypoxia, where despite the lower oxygen levels, they manage to not only survive but thrive. This is achieved by boosting the production of red blood cells, enhancing the blood’s oxygen-carrying capacity. This adaptation might just be the secret to better health and slower aging.

At the Peak of Youth – Telomeres Tell the Tale

At the heart of cellular aging are telomeres, the end caps of chromosomes that protect our genetic data. These caps naturally shorten as we age; however, the thin air of high altitudes might just put the brakes on this process. While the science is still climbing this particular mountain, early research suggests that high-altitude living could be linked to longer telomeres, hinting at a fascinating altitude-longevity connection.

Heart Rates High, Risks Low?

The altitude workout isn’t just about spectacular views but also includes a cardiovascular boost. Increased heart rate and adjusted blood pressure are typical responses to high-altitude living as the body works harder to oxygenate the blood. Interestingly, this might be a workout routine your heart appreciates, as studies show a notably lower risk of heart disease among those living at higher elevations.

Living High or Living Long?

It’s easy to romanticize the idea of mountain living with its apparent promise of longevity. Yet, the secret to the enduring health of high-altitude populations like those in the Andes or Himalayas isn’t just the air. Lifestyle factors such as diet, physical activity, and community play equally critical roles. Thus, while altitude might be a factor, it’s just one piece of the longevity puzzle.

Lessons from the Heights

Adapting to low oxygen levels involves more than just gasping for breath; it activates complex physiological pathways like the Hypoxia-Inducible Factor (HIF) pathway. This adaptation not only helps in survival but might also enhance metabolic efficiency and promote longevity. This suggests that adapting to environmental stresses could have profound health benefits.
